COURSE OVERVIEW

All Hands Fire offers comprehensive training programs designed to educate firefighters, hazardous materials personnel, and emergency responders on the identification, hazards, and response strategies associated with lithium-ion battery emergencies.  Most courses are instructed by FDNY Special Operations HazMat personnel with extensive real-world operational experience, providing students with practical insights gained from responding to complex battery incidents.

These in-depth classroom programs establish a strong foundation in lithium-ion battery construction, chemistry, electrical concepts, and failure mechanisms before progressing into real-world response considerations involving consumer electronics, electric vehicles (EVs), and battery energy storage systems (BESS).

Students will learn how to recognize the warning signs of battery failure, identify and interrupt thermal runaway, evaluate hazards, conduct risk assessments, select appropriate suppression and containment strategies, and operate safely in environments impacted by lithium-ion battery failures.

The Technician-level program expands on these core concepts through advanced instruction in fire suppression operations, hazardous materials response, incident risk assessment, tactical decision-making, and evolving industry best practices.  Graduates will leave the program with the knowledge and confidence to safely and effectively manage complex lithium-ion battery emergencies across a wide range of response environments.

FIRE DEPARTMENT CONSIDERATIONS FOR LITHIUM-ION BATTERIES

This awareness-level program provides emergency responders with a practical introduction to lithium-ion battery technology, associated hazards, and emergency response considerations.  The course examines battery chemistry, common failure mechanisms, thermal runaway, and response strategies for incidents involving micro-mobility devices, consumer electronics, electric vehicles (EVs), and residential and commercial battery energy storage systems (BESS).  Students will gain the knowledge to recognize hazards, conduct effective risk assessments, and understand current firefighting and safety best practices for lithium-ion battery emergencies.

LITHIUM-ION BATTERY EMERGENCIES: OPERATIONS

4 hours

This 4-hour operations-level program provides emergency responders with essential knowledge of lithium-ion battery hazards and safe response strategies.  Developed by FDNY Special Operations HazMat instructors with real-world experience, the course is delivered as instructor-led classroom instruction covering battery construction, thermal runaway, electrical hazards, PPE, suppression, and containment concepts.  Students will learn to recognize hazards, perform size-up, and apply safe mitigation strategies for incidents involving consumer electronics, electric vehicles (EVs), and energy storage systems.

LITHIUM-ION BATTERY EMERGENCIES: TECHNICIAN

8 hours

This comprehensive 8-hour technician-level program provides firefighters, hazmat technicians, and emergency responders with an in-depth understanding of lithium-ion battery technology, hazards, and advanced response strategies.  Developed by FDNY Special Operations HazMat instructors with extensive real-world experience, the course explores battery construction, chemistry, thermal runaway, fire operations, hazmat response, risk assessment, and tactical decision-making.  Through classroom instruction and live demonstrations, students will develop the knowledge and confidence to safely assess, mitigate, and manage complex lithium-ion battery incidents involving consumer electronics, electric vehicles (EVs), and battery energy storage systems (BESS).
